Bornean Water Shrew vs Isarog Chrotomys
Chimarrogale phaeura compared with Chrotomys gonzalesi
Key Differences
- Bornean Water Shrew is Endangered while Isarog Chrotomys is Near Threatened.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bornean Water Shrew | Isarog Chrotomys |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(hayvan) | Animalia (hayvan)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Kordalılar) | Chordata (Kordalılar) |
| Class same | Mammalia (memeliler) | Mammalia (memeliler)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Rodentia (kemiriciler) |
| Family | Soricidae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Chimarrogale | Chrotomys |
| Species | Chimarrogale phaeura | Chrotomys gonzalesi |
Evolutionary Relationship
Bornean Water Shrew and Isarog Chrotomys share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(memeliler)
